The Process of Applying for a Driver License Online
While the particular procedures might vary from state to state (or nation to nation), the following steps typically lay out how to tackle obtaining a driver's license online:
1. Examine Eligibility
Before diving into the application process, individuals need to verify their eligibility. Particular states have particular requirements that should be fulfilled, such as age, evidence of residency, and conclusion of a driver's education course.
2. Gather Required Documents
Depending upon the state, applicants might need to collect numerous files, consisting of:
Proof of identity (e.g., birth certificate or passport)Social Security numberEvidence of residency (e.g., energy bill)Driver's education certificate (if relevant)3. Check Out the Official Website
People ought to go to the official motor lorry department website for their state or country. It is vital to ensure that it is an official federal government website to safeguard individual information.
4. Fill Out the Application Form
Online applications need conclusion of a comprehensive form. It is important to examine all offered details carefully to avoid errors that could postpone the application.
5. Pay the Fee
A lot of jurisdictions need a fee for processing the driver's license application. Payment is normally made through secure online channels with choices for credit or debit cards.
6. Send the Application
After verification and evaluation, the application can be submitted. Applicants can often expect to get a confirmation email describing the next steps and estimated timeline.
7. Validate Status
Many states use a method to check the status of an application online. This feature enables candidates to remain notified on whether their application has actually been processed and when they can expect their license.
Essential Considerations
In spite of the benefits of online applications, it is vital to be cognizant of some potential risks:
Fraud Prevention: Be wary of unofficial sites trying to charge unreasonable fees or collect personal information without proper authorization.
System Outages: Online systems can experience downtime or technical issues. It is advisable to begin the procedure early in anticipation of any disruptions.
In-Person Requirements: Some states might still need in-person verification, particularly for acquiring the first license or for specific situations like restoring a license after a suspension.
